The UK\u2019s largest dedicated kitchens, bedrooms and bathrooms exhibition kbb Birmingham, returns from 3-6th<\/sup> of March 2024. Taking place at the NEC, kbb Birmingham will feature over 230+ exhibiting brands from across 26 different categories, featuring the very latest innovations and cutting-edge designs. The biennial event welcomes an audience of over 15,000 visitors over the four days, attracting senior decision-makers from the residential, design, retail and contract sectors. <\/strong><\/p>\n

KBB Birmingham will feature a wide range of Europe\u2019s most established and prestigious KBB brands. Exhibitors already confirmed include Electrolux, Aga Rangemaster, InSinkErator, Franke, Roca, Hanex, Nolte, Nobilia, Leicht, Harrison Bathrooms, Microvellum, Sachsenkuechen, Bariperfil, Turkish Ceramics, Leda Bathrooms, Sonas Bathrooms, Creada, St James Collection, Tru Blu and many others. From kitchen furniture and bathroom accessories to components, surfaces and worktops, kbb Birmingham presents the very latest designs. Better Stands Initiative<\/strong><\/p>\n

Better Stands is kbb Birmingham\u2019s parent company Infoma\u2019s landmark campaign to reduce the waste that stands at exhibitions can create. The team is working with customers to phase out all disposable stands at EMEA events by 2024. Better Stands also shows how sustainable business can be better business too. Reusable structures not only reduce waste, but they can reduce the time it takes to construct and take down stands, reduce the cost of design and construction and allow for investment in higher quality and more successful stands. All KBB Birmingham exhibitors are encouraged to either reuse or recycle at the end of the show, to help create a more sustainable event.<\/p>\n

The Used Kitchen Company (TUKC) will once again be partnering with the event to help exhibitors sell their displays ahead of the show to encourage a more sustainable event, and to make a valuable contribution towards recycling within the kitchen industry.<\/p>\n
